18.2 SEM_RDFSA.DISABLE_OLS_POLICY

形式

SEM_RDFSA.DISABLE_OLS_POLICY(
     network_owner IN VARCHAR2 DEFAULT NULL,
     network_name  IN VARCHAR2 DEFAULT NULL);

説明

すでにセマンティク・データ・ストアに適用されている、または有効にされているOLSポリシーを無効にします。

パラメータ

network_owner

セマンティク・ネットワークの所有者。(表1-2を参照してください。)

network_name

セマンティク・ネットワークの名前。(表1-2を参照してください。)

使用に関するノート

このプロシージャを使用すると、セマンティク・データ・ストアに適用されている、または有効にされているOLSポリシーを一時的に無効にできます。ポリシーを無効にするユーザーは、OLSポリシーを管理するために必要な権限を持つ必要があり、また、RDFデータに適用されるOLSポリシーにアクセスする必要もあります。

様々なRDFリソースおよびトリプルに割り当てられる機密性ラベルは保持され、OLSポリシーはこれらを実施するために再有効化される場合があります。OLSポリシーが無効である場合、特定のラベルを持つ新しいリソースを追加したり、既存のトリプルおよびリソースのラベルを更新することができます。

OLSポリシーを適用するには、SEM_RDFSA.APPLY_OLS_POLICYプロシージャを使用し、無効になっていたOLSポリシーを有効にするには、SEM_RDFSA.ENABLE_OLS_POLICYプロシージャを使用します。

OLSのサポートの詳細は、RDFデータのファイングレイン・アクセス制御を参照してください。

セマンティク・ネットワークのタイプおよびオプションの詳細は、「RDFネットワーク」を参照してください。

次の例では、セマンティク・データ・ストアのOLSポリシーを無効にします。

begin
  sem_rdfsa.disable_ols_policy;
end;
/